fleet/ — the atom registry

The fleet is Arcodange's AI back-office: narrow agents ("atoms") that operate the Dolibarr ERP's daily admin & accounting under the AI back-office PRD. This directory is the registry — the versioned source of truth for what the fleet may do. An atom absent from the registry does not run. Contract semantics come from the PRD atom contract; file syntax from the PRD document surface.

What an atom is

One narrow capability (classify, extract, validate, record, reconcile, report, remind) with a strict I/O contract and deterministic validators around it. The LLM proposes, code disposes: formats, arithmetic, checksums, dedupe and referential integrity are enforced by validators, and a model output that fails validation is quarantined, never auto-corrected. Workflows are compositions of atoms with explicit gates — never one prompt that "does the accounting".

Each atom lives in fleet/atoms/<atom>/:

File Role
atom.yaml the registry entry — the contract (schema below)
prompt.md thin runtime prompt, ≤ ~40 lines, extends exactly one class skeleton; no business rules (rules live in fleet/profile/ and in validators)
scripts/ the deterministic implementation: runners, validators, scoring hooks

Folder name = atom name = registry name — the house <app> join-key discipline applied to atoms.

atom.yaml — the contract, field by field

Per the PRD atom contract:

Field Meaning
name, version Identity. Folder name = name. version bumps on any behavioral change (prompt, model, validator) — a bump re-triggers the atom's golden-set evals.
input_schema / output_schema JSON Schema for the atom's I/O; enforced at runtime (constrained decoding where the model tier supports it).
invariants Deterministic post-conditions checked by code after every run (e.g. HT + TVA == TTC ± 0.01). A failed invariant quarantines the output — refuse, never repair.
side_effect_class read · draft · write-sandbox · write-prod · outbound — drives which gates and credentials apply, per the PRD environment posture table.
idempotency_key How a replay is recognized (e.g. supplier + ref_supplier + TTC) — a second run with the same key must be a no-op.
autonomy The earned level (A0A3 on the autonomy ladder) + a pointer to the eval evidence that justifies it.
model_policy Preferred tier, fallbacks, escalation rule, per the PRD model fleet; closed per-atom by routing-bench evidence (erp#45 for the first atoms).
eval_ref Where the golden set + scoring script live (fleet/golden/<atom>/).

Two registry conveniences beyond the PRD contract fields bind the entry to the rest of the surface: class (which fleet/classes/<class>.md skeleton the prompt extends) and task (the PRD task-inventory id the atom serves).

The worked example is atoms/invoice-extract/atom.yaml (T02) — contract only; its implementation is erp#40.

How an atom graduates

Autonomy is earned per atom, never assumed. The levels (A0 manual → A1 prepare → A2 rehearse + gate → A3 autonomous + audit) are defined on the PRD autonomy ladder; promotion and demotion are mechanical, per the PRD autonomy promotion gates (golden-set evals, unedited-approval streaks, incident demotion — the bars live there, not here). The earned level and its evidence are recorded in the atom's autonomy field: a promotion is a PR that changes that field with the evidence linked, verified per the QA strategy's independent-verification rule.

Conventions

  • English for all agent-facing files (house language policy).
  • Same-change freshness: a change to an atom that leaves its atom.yaml / prompt.md stale is an incomplete change.
  • One capability per file; YAML/frontmatter over prose for anything a machine parses.
  • Environment rules (trunk hygiene, read-only prod, sandbox-first writes, promote gate) are the repo-wide ones: AGENTS.md operating rules + dolibarr-sandbox-write SKILL.md.
